Sexting Arrest Latest Embarrassment For Secret Service

BALTIMORE (WJZ) -- Yet another public black eye for the Secret Service. This time, it's an agent from Maryland at the center of the scandal. The 37-year-old is arrested for sending naked pictures to someone he thought was a 14-year-old girl.

Derek Valcourt with more on the allegations against that agent.

The Secret Service has been taking a lot of hits lately. Now, one of their own is facing some possible jail time.

Thirty-seven-year-old Secret Service Agent Lee Robert Moore of Church Hill, Maryland thought he was texting and communicating with a 14-year-old girl. In reality, the sexually explicit messages and photos he sent were going to an undercover Delaware state police detective.

"That kind of conduct has no place in any kind of job, let alone one where someone's involved in public trust," said Rep. Chris Val Holland, (D) Maryland.

Moore faces federal and state charges. His attorney had little to say.

"The case has been transferred to Superior Court jurisdiction, and I have no further comment," said John Barber, attorney.

Moore's arrest is the latest in a series of embarrassing incidents for the Secret Service.

Last year, a man armed with a knife jumped a security fence, making it all the way into the White House. That came one year after a headline-grabbing prostitution scandal involving 11 Secret Service agents assigned to protect the president while he was on a trip to South America.

Earlier this year, a pair of off-duty Secret Service supervisors reported to be likely intoxicated drove through an active bomb threat scene at the White House.

An audit this year also found two agents asleep on the job.

"One bad apple can cause a whole organization to look bad," said Rep, Dutch Ruppersberger, (D) Maryland.

Congressman Ruppersberger is one of several in Congress who want to see more improvements in Secret Service performance.

"They have to evaluate their management style, what checks and balances they have and how they're holding people accountable," he said.

As for Agent Lee Robert Moore, the Secret Service says it takes these allegations extremely seriously and he was immediately placed on administrative leave.

According to court records, Moore confessed to having a sexual interest in 14-year-old girls.
